20-21 Ardbeg Road, Rothesay, Bute is a Grade C listed building in the Argyll and Bute local planning authority area, Scotland. First listed on 12 November 1997. Flatted house.

Description

20-21 Ardbeg Road is a symmetrical, two-storey, three-bay flatted house built in the earlier to mid 19th century, with mid 20th century alterations. It is designed in a plain classical style and forms one of a pair of similar buildings. The house is accessed from both the front and rear. It features painted rubble sandstone with raised, painted margins and painted strip quoins. The building has a raised base course, a lintel course beneath corniced eaves, a pilastered doorpiece, and projecting cills. The rear has harl-pointed random rubble with raised, painted margins and a part-rendered exterior stair. There is also a single-storey, four-bay outbuilding at the rear, which is harl-pointed.

On the east elevation, there are steps leading to a part-glazed, two-leaf timber panelled door at the center of the ground floor, topped by an opaque-glazed fanlight. The door is framed by a corniced doorpiece with flanking pilasters, a plain frieze, a block pediment, and a raised keystone. The first floor has a single window at the center, with additional single windows in the outer bays on both floors. Above, there are three-light canted dormers.

The west elevation at the rear features a balustraded stair leading to the upper flat, offset to the left of center, with a single opening and a multi-paned fanlight. There are single windows in the remaining bays on both floors, along with piended single and tripartite dormers.

The building predominantly has replacement glazing and a graded grey slate roof with raised skews and corniced apex stacks at both the north and south ends, along with various circular cans.

The interior was not seen in 1996. The outbuilding has a three-light window in the penultimate bay to the outer right and boarded timber doors in the remaining bays. It has a grey slate roof and a harled, flat-roofed addition to the outer left.

The boundary wall along Ardbeg Road is a low coped random rubble wall with a replacement cast-iron pedestrian entry gate. There are corniced square-plan piers at the outer left and right, each topped with square caps.
